Escape to the rolling hills of small-town Haven, where a new chapter begins in Flora Wilder's enchanting debut. Chloe arrives in this idyllic small town with her spirited cat Duke, hoping to leave behind a challenging past. Captivated by a weathered brick house nestled in the Palouse, she sets out to transform it into a thriving flower farm, her hands digging into the soil as she seeks renewal amidst the rolling landscape. Yet, she soon stumbles into the town's delightful chaos, a whirlwind of unexpected warmth and whimsy. Haven greets her with open arms and a cast of unforgettable characters: the mystical Tami, whose uncanny insights seem to guide every step with a knowing wink, and Leo, the thoughtful hardware store owner whose gentle demeanor hides a smoldering intensity and his own troubled history. As Chloe plants her roots, she finds a sisterhood among fierce, caring girlfriends who lift her with laughter and support, their bond a steady anchor through her trials. Meanwhile, Leo's glances spark a chemistry promising heated moments under the stars, a connection that teases the heart with every shared moment. This heartwarming tale of second chances, found family, and sisterhood weaves together the beauty of nature's cycles, a dash of heat, and plenty of chuckles. From moonlit gatherings to the town's uproarious Founders Day parade (complete with an inflatable turkey incident), Wilder crafts a story of healing and possibility, blending emotional depth with lighthearted joy. The scent of blooming flowers, the hush of rolling hills, and the rustle of stormy winds create a backdrop where love and laughter thrive.
